Product Information
The Legal Practice Course Guides have been revised, expanded and updated to take account of the many changes in legislation and course structure that have happened in the last year. Each guide explains the relevant substantive and procedural law and, where appropriate, contains sample precedents, documents and checklists. The books provide a guide to the law, notes, exercises and case studies produced by each institution and the raw material found in the practitioner texts. This guide deals with the contractual and statutory issues that arise in the individual employment law setting. It covers matters of formation and operation of the contract of employment confidentiality, restraint of trade and transfer of businesses, discrimination, as well as the statutory rights of unfair dismissal and redundancy. It is designed for use on Legal Practice Courses which take either a corporate or private client bias, and offers a practical and comprehensive guide to the preventative measures that can be taken and the problems most commonly presented to a solicitor. This 1999 edition includes material on the impact of recent developments in statutory material as well as practical guidance on the ever-increasing mass of case law and European legislation.
